The represents a specialized, high-fidelity audio remaster of one of history's greatest rock albums. In the audiophile and bootleg communities, custom preservation projects aim to bypass the limitations of commercial compression. These fan-led initiatives restore the dynamic range, tonal balance, and spatial imaging of original studio analog tapes.

The "Yeraycito" label refers to a renowned independent audio engineer and archivist celebrated within the bootleg and audiophile community. Yeraycito specializes in sourcing the finest available analog pressings—often rare, first-generation vinyl transfers or early reel-to-reel tapes—and meticulously restoring them.
